Перейти к содержанию

    

Недостаток - под каждый символ, и футпринт нужно создавать отдельную библиотеку. или разбить существующую, на множество библиотек.

Датабуку проигрывает в верификации на соответствии базе.

Я все думал - зачем люди делают под каждый компонент отдельные библиотеки :biggrin: тут даже понятие библиотека вырождается. Танцы с бубном, одним словом. то мы их пакуем, теперь мы их распаковываем, и распыляем.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ты
Недостаток - под каждый символ, и футпринт нужно создавать отдельную библиотеку. или разбить существующую, на множество библиотек.

Я все думал - зачем люди делают под каждый компонент отдельные библиотеки :biggrin: тут даже понятие библиотека вырождается.

Скажу честно- мне таки не удалось сформулировать ответ на эту беспросветную чушь так чтобы не нарушить правила форума, поэтому попробую зайти с другой стороны: как так вышло что вокруг полно библиотек альтиума в которых нет отдельной библиотеки под каждый символ и футпринт? В частности, как так вышло что есть интегрированные(нередактируеммые библиотеки)в которых есть все сразу?

Датабуку проигрывает в верификации на соответствии базе.

:biggrin: Каким образом? :biggrin:

Танцы с бубном, одним словом. то мы их пакуем, теперь мы их распаковываем, и распыляем.

Это что же вы там собираетесь паковать/распаковывать? :biggrin:

 

ПС. Разумеется как и ожидалось вопросы на знание сути игнорируются :biggrin: Это общая черта местных фанатиков ментора которые неспособны ответить за свои слова.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ты
:biggrin: Каким образом? :biggrin:

 

If the libraries for the symbols and models are being newly created, there is no problem ensuring only one symbol/model per file. Typically however, the source libraries will already exist. To simplify the job of separating these libraries into single-entity files for addition to the SVN repository, Altium Designer provides a splitting tool - the Library Splitter Wizard.

 

DBLIB_LibrarySplitterEx_17_0.png

 

:biggrin: Каким образом? :biggrin:

 

Одним из существующих.

Можно DBLib создать из IntLib. Возможен и другой путь - IntLib из DBLib. Как по мне - это костыли Альтиума, никак не упрощающие работу.

 

О Сути этой чепухи обращайтесь в супорт Альтиума.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ты
If the libraries for the symbols and models are being newly created

Специально сохранил страницу целиком чтобы потом с коллегами вспоминать как байки, но вернемся к вопросу :biggrin: Раз уж вы цитируете хелп, то непонятно почему так поздно и так мало- первое пока оставим, а вот по второму надо добавлять вот что:

The Library Splitter Wizard quickly converts multi-component schematic symbol (*.SchLib), PCB footprint (*.PcbLib), and PCB3D model (*.PCB3DLib) libraries into single-model files. Storing each model in its own file is more appropriate for version-controlled source and is required before the symbol and model libraries are added to an SVN repository - as part of the Version-Controlled Database Library feature (SVNDBLib).

Потому как нет ни малейшей необходимости и каких-либо предпосылок хранить для каждого компонента отдельную библиотеку :biggrin: Это сугубо ваши фантазии и попытки родить аргумент

Одним из существующих.

Очень интересно :laughing: - что же там такое :biggrin: ? Не стесняетесь, реально очень интересно послушать вашу трактовку :biggrin:

Можно DBLib создать из IntLib. Возможен и другой путь - IntLib из DBLib.О Сути этой чепухи обращайтесь в супорт Альтиума.

В этом нет нужды- если не знали, в хелпе так и написано что:

Regardless of the type of database library used, the underlying principal of the feature remains the same in each case - the ability to place directly from the linked external database. To make this powerful feature as accessible as possible, tools are provided that enable you to quickly move existing libraries into the database library structure.

Если и так непонятно то вкратце перефразирую на великий и могучий- в альтиуме можно организовать библиотеки как душе угодно, никаких врожденных методологий нет. К слову последнюю фразу я уже использовал неоднократно, еще к ней вернусь в этой теме :biggrin:

Как по мне - это костыли Альтиума, никак не упрощающие работу.

Не нужно стоять в стороне- расскажите как именно это костылит и усложняет процесс работы? С какими проблемами вы столкнулись? Или тоже тупой бессмысленный фейк как и остальное вашего авторства?

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ты
в альтиуме можно организовать библиотеки как душе угодно, никаких врожденных методологий нет

 

И в альтиуме, как душе угодно, можно делать многое. И вы заблуждаетесь в базовых понятиях проектирования, отсутствие методологии - это недостаток.

 

 

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ты
И вы заблуждаетесь в базовых понятиях проектирования, отсутствие методологии - это недостаток.

Безусловно мне очень интересно послушать о своих заблуждениях именно от вас, особенно после всех ваших сказок и выдумок :laughing:,но на всякий случай напоминаю- нет, не факт того что вы снова не в состоянии ответить на ранее заданные вопросы(это само собой :biggrin: )- а то, что возможность использовать разные методологии это далеко не то же самое что и отсутствие какой-либо методологии. Про базовые понятия проектирования тоже заливать не стоит, вы и эту тему не вывезете :biggrin:

И в альтиуме, как душе угодно, можно делать многое.

Что безусловно является одним из самых больших его богатств и позволяет делать инструмент пригодным для очень разных пользователей с очень разными запросами.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Кстати, а как в Альтиуме обстоят дела с одновременной работой нескольких инженеров над одной бордой? Пару лет назад приходилось работать руками в режиме копипаста, как сейчас? Вижу какие-то рекламные видео, но интересно как это реально работает. В Менторе эти функции (Xtreme PCB, Team PCB) реализованы очень хорошо на мой взгляд, думаю в Cadence тоже.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ты
Потому как нет ни малейшей необходимости и каких-либо предпосылок хранить для каждого компонента отдельную библиотеку :biggrin: Это сугубо ваши фантазии и попытки родить аргумент

 

As the split library files will be added to the SVN repository, it can be a good idea to setup the folder structure that you want in the repository - in terms of the symbol/model files - locally on your hard disk. Once the structure is defined, copy the source libraries to their respective folders within that structure. You can then simply delete the original source library from each folder and add the folders to the repository, using the SVN client you have decided to use.

 

так нужны symbol and model libraries или нет? вы этими цитатами сами себе противоречите. Я же не говорил что их нужно хранить, вот Альтиумовцы предлагают good idea :biggrin: создать структуру папок, simply поразмещать, simply поудалять ненужное.

 

 

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ты
так нужны symbol and model libraries или нет?

Если речь о том единичном специфическом случае описанном в хелпе то да, нужны. В остальных случаях- ни разу и никогда :laughing:

вы этими цитатами сами себе противоречите.

Какими и где? :biggrin:

Я же не говорил что их нужно хранить

Что правда то правда- вы предлагали их создавать(для каждого отдельного компонента), не хранить(но без хранения видимо никак, иначе зачем все это). И потом торжественно хотели преподнести это не как частный случай для конкретной цели, а как standard flow вообще для альтиума. Ну, хотеть не вредно :laughing: - однако нет, стандартный(и не очень)путь это когда в либе столько компонентов сколько надо.

вот Альтиумовцы предлагают good idea biggrin.gif создать структуру папок, simply поразмещать, simply поудалять ненужное.

Вы когда в следующий раз будете наугад копировать неполные куски из хелпа, хотя бы в интернете ролики поищите, ну или сам хелп почитайте весь- потому как это уже и не аргумент, а какой-то унылый высер :laughing:

так нужны symbol and model libraries или нет?

Если речь о работе с проектом то первое(т.е *.SchLib) безусловно нужно, второе нет :biggrin:

Кстати, а как в Альтиуме обстоят дела с одновременной работой нескольких инженеров над одной бордой?

В рамках сравнения с EDA опцией уровня аллегро/экспедишина для одновременной работы- никак не обстоят и не существуют в природе.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Для публикации сообщений создайте учётную запись или авторизуйтесь

Вы должны быть пользователем, чтобы оставить комментарий

Создать учетную запись

Зарегистрируйте новую учётную запись в нашем сообществе. Это очень просто!

Регистрация нового пользователя

Войти

Уже есть аккаунт? Войти в систему.

Войти